My 09 G Sedan is MUCH more tight than my outgoing 06 Altima. That said, I do have a rear deck rattle that can be easily reproduced. Lots of other people have had it so its probably just not great design. I'm going to try to stop it myself.
I do hear some cracking when the interior is super hot and starts cooling as you turn on the a/c but its nothing out of the ordinary. TONS of other cars have that too. Just get into a new 3 series and push on some of the plastic and it makes simmilar sounds.
BTW: The G is a great great car and a STEAL for the price.
